Compact power!
I was replacing an older pistol light on my full-size S&W M&P9. I was pleasantly surprised at the balance of compact size and power this device provides. If fits perfectly in the profile of my pistol, behind the end of the barrel and within the width of the slide! The ambidextrous buttons fit perfectly along the trigger guard and are knurled so you can find them easily. Super bright light and laser paired with rechargeable batteries are perfection. Requires a proprietary battery pack but Nitecore does sell spares (and dual chargers) on their site if you need extras. My only real complaint is the lack of a quick release mechanism to remove the device. However, this is such a minor thing it's more whining than actual issue. TL;DR It's small but mighty!

Nifty design from a company I like.
I needed a new light for a new handgun and this one fit the bill. Nitecore isn't high end priced but in my opinion it has high end quality and high end customer service. When I saw it used a magnetic charger, I didn't look any further. I figured it was something like the OLight magnetic setups. It is not. You have to remove the proprietary battery, which is quick-release easy, and then charge it. At first I was a bit bummed until I found they sell that battery for a reasonable price and a two battery charger for an equally reasonable price, so I ordered those. Now I'm pretty happy about the idea. If my light is dead, I don't have to charge it before use, I can swap batteries and let the dead one charge while I go out and play. The adjustability of the pick rail mount lets you get the light snugged back against the trigger guard nicely for whatever handgun you are using I'd suspect. That's another feature OLight also does well, but this one actually seems a little more solid. It isn't too wide either. It will ride on a Tisas PX-5.7 Raptor wich I picked up on the cheap just to experience the 5.7 round. It fits well and looks like the blocking process for when I build the kydex holster will be a breeze. No big, knobby controls. Everything is tight and narrow, even with the laser.
